2025-11-17 | Kompania Piwowarska’s Safe Construction Site Recognized

We are pleased to announce that the construction of the automatic high-bay warehouse in Poznań, commissioned by Kompania Piwowarska and managed and supervised by APP-Projekt, has won first place in the Wielkopolska region in the National Labour Inspectorate’s “Build Safely” competition.

This distinction highlights the high safety standards that Kompania Piwowarska consistently implements across all its investments. As one of the largest brewers in Poland, the company has long prioritized responsible project management, modern technologies, and a safe working environment. The award confirms that this project fully reflects those values.

APP-Projekt is responsible for comprehensive project management — from design and development of safety procedures, through investor supervision and the tender process, to monitoring occupational health and safety throughout construction and commissioning. A key role was played by our HSE inspector, whose commitment, precision, and attention to detail were crucial to achieving this recognition.

The “Build Safely” competition, organized by the National Labour Inspectorate, promotes projects carried out with exceptional care for working conditions. The Kompania Piwowarska project has also advanced to the national stage of the competition.

The awards ceremony will take place on 20 November 2025 at the Voivodeship Office in Poznań.

The investment includes the construction of one of the most advanced automatic high-bay warehouses in Poland — a facility with an area of 12,000 m², a height of 40 meters, and a capacity of 40,000 pallets. The project also covers supporting infrastructure, an office and staff building, traditional warehouse halls, and the reconstruction of Szwajcarska Street. The General Contractor for the project is PORR S.A.
